Regional Analysis of Japan Valves for Oil and Gas Market

Japan’s regional landscape for valve demand exhibits significant variation driven by economic activity, industry concentration, and technological adoption. The Tokyo metropolitan area remains the epicenter of high-value projects, benefiting from advanced infrastructure, regulatory support, and a dense concentration of energy corporations. The Kansai region, including Osaka and Kobe, shows rapid growth fueled by industrial diversification and modernization efforts.

In contrast, northern regions such as Hokkaido have slower growth due to lower industrial density but present niche opportunities in renewable energy integration and small-scale exploration. The Chubu region, with its petrochemical clusters, sustains steady demand for specialized valves. Frequently Asked Questions (FAQs) about Japan Valves for Oil and Gas Market

What are the main types of valves used in Japan’s oil and gas industry?

Ball valves, gate valves, globe valves, and butterfly valves are the primary types, with ball and gate valves dominating due to their reliability in high-pressure and high-temperature environments.
